The National Civil Aviation Agency (ANAC) launched this Friday, January 21, Public Consultation No. 2 of 2022 on the proposed amendments to the Brazilian Civil Aviation Regulations (RBACs) No. 01 and No. 21, which deals with requirements airworthiness standards adopted by ANAC for the Light Sport Aircraft (ALE) category.

On February 3, the Agency will hold a virtual public hearing to collect verbal manifestations from interested parties.          

The changes proposed in the amendments presented in this consultation are the result of the work of the Mixed Study Group established by ANAC, in April of last year, to evaluate the current norms and the possibility of expanding the category.

Additionally, in May 2021, the Agency opened a Subsidy Receipt (click on the link to access) to collect evaluations from the target audience on the advantages and disadvantages of a special light sport aircraft when compared to other categories, such as certified and experimental aircraft of amateur construction.

The regulatory changes for ALE in Brazil and the category expansion make up the themes of the ANAC Regulatory Agenda 2021-2022, which provides for the matters that should receive priority action in the Agency's standardization process, taking into the impacts that will be generated on society .
